Who we are
SEAL – an acronym for SIL Engineering and Atex Laboratory – was founded with the goal of providing testing and consulting services to third parties in Italy and across Europe in the field of gas detection.
The principles of Functional Safety (SIL Engineering) are becoming increasingly important in the design of electronic devices. These requirements are specified in various standards for gas detection, for industrial safety applications, and, more recently, in the Refrigeration and Hydrogen detection sectors.

Consulting and Testing for Gas Detection
There are very few laboratories in Europe currently offering this type of consulting service in the field of gas detection.
The Atex Laboratory within SEAL was created to support End Users and certification bodies operating throughout Europe in the gas detection market.
Moreover, regarding compliance testing for gas detection standards, the involved certification bodies specialize in the performance requirements defined by European standards such as:
- EN 50104 (Oxygen detection)
- EN 50291 (Domestic Carbon Monoxide detection)
- IEC 62990-1
- EN 60079-29-1 and ISO 26142 (Hydrogen detection)
- EN 50676 e EN14624 in Europe (Refrigerant Gas detection)
- International standards such as IEC 60079-29-0 and ISO 26142 (Hydrogen detection).

Test the Performance of Your Sensors with SEAL
SEAL was created to support instrument manufacturers and certification bodies by providing a single gateway to the requirements of the European gas detection market.
SEAL specializes in offering testing and test certificates under the supervision of certification bodies (e.g., CESI, TÜV Süd, BV, etc.), in accordance with the ISO 17025 quality standard and performance standards for gas detection in the Security/Safety, Refrigeration, Hydrogen, and Off-Gas sectors, following both European and International Standards.
